Graphic Designer

Overview

Systems Planning and Analysis, Inc. (SPA) delivers high-impact, technical solutions to complex national security issues. With over 50 years of business expertise and consistent growth, we are known for continuous innovation for our government customers, in both the US and abroad. Our exceptionally talented team is highly collaborative in spirit and practice, producing Results that Matter. Come work with the best! We offer opportunity, unique challenges, and clear-sighted commitment to the mission. SPA: Objective. Responsive. Trusted.  

 

Our group, the Joint Defense Support Group within SPA’s Sea Land Air (SLA) Division, supports the Surface community and components of the United States Navy by providing program management, requirements management, force development, and readiness support in Washington DC and the Fleet concentration areas. We provide timely, objective, analytic assessments, strategic planning, and expert operational, technical, and acquisition support to the Maritime communities, and related agencies, allies, and partners. We are trusted agents of the senior and operational leadership in the Fleet, OPNAV, NAVSEA, and the Royal Canadian and Royal Australian Navies. We play key roles in providing insights and strategies to address current and emerging challenges to national security and have tremendous impact on our client’s success in solving their most important issues.

 

SPA has an immediate need for a Graphic Designer to support OPNAV N1 Commander's Action Group (CAG). #MC

#MC

Responsibilities

The Commander's Action Group (CAG) Graphic Designer should be able to prepare formal technical drawings, graphics and illustrations in support of strategy development, operations and support functions; provide formal format and layout functions for MyNavy HR Enterprise publications; provide creative copywriting support including creating, editing, layout, and proofreading and provide scriptwriting support; and producing original creative concepts and developing storylines from concept to completed product.  The Graphic Designer should also be able to support any other CAG client needs including communications planning, execution, and support documentation.

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or's degree in Graphic Arts, Graphic Design or related field
  • 5 years of relevant work experience in developing multi-media projects, graphics, and illustrations in Adobe Suite or Power Point.
  • SECRET Clearance, and the ability to maintain it throughout employment
  • In office support required

Desired Qualifications: 

  • Knowledge of Navy manpower and personnel programs
